虚拟化技术近年来在个人用户和企业环境中越来越普及。尤其是在Windows操作系统上运行Linux,无疑成为了许多技术爱好者和开发者的热门选择。通过虚拟机,用户可以便捷地使用Linux的强大功能,而不必放弃他们熟悉的Windows环境。本文将探讨如何在Windows上搭建虚拟机与操作系统,涵盖性能评测、市场趋势以及一些实用的DIY技巧和性能优化策略。

对于初学者而言,选择合适的虚拟机软件是至关重要的。目前市场上常见的虚拟机软件包括VMware Workstation、Oracle VirtualBox以及Hyper-V等。各有其特点与优势,VMware以其稳定性和丰富的功能受到企业用户的青睐,而VirtualBox则因其开源及跨平台特性而受到广泛欢迎。
性能评测是用户选择虚拟机软件的重要参考指标。在Windows上运行Linux的虚拟机性能,受到宿主机配置、虚拟机设置和Linux发行版等多种因素的影响。通常而言,使用较新版本的Windows和高性能硬件可以显著提升虚拟机的运行效率。例如,启用VT-x或AMD-V硬件虚拟化技术,可以带来显著的性能提升。分配足够的RAM和CPU核心也是确保虚拟机流畅运行的关键。
当谈及市场趋势时,云计算的普及让虚拟化技术发展迅速。越来越多的企业采用虚拟机技术来提高资源利用率,降低成本。用户对于在本地主机上运行多个操作系统的需求也日益增长。未来,随着硬件性能的提升和软件技术的发展,虚拟机的性能将继续优化,用户体验会更加流畅。
DIY组装虚拟机时,有几个实用技巧可以帮助用户更好地利用资源。通过配置快速存储设备(如SSD)来放置虚拟机文件,可以显著提高读写速度,从而改善整体性能。合理的网络设置也是了不起的优化之一,例如,利用桥接模式或NAT模式配置网络,能够让虚拟机更好地与宿主系统或外部网络互动。
在选择Linux发行版时,用户需考虑发行版的资源消耗及其对虚拟化的支持。Ubuntu、Fedora及CentOS等都是良好的选择,它们相对较轻,适合虚拟化环境。用户还可以根据自己的需求选择合适的桌面环境,从XFCE到GNOME,轻量级的桌面环境能有效节省内存,提升虚拟机的响应速度。
尽管在Windows上运行Linux的过程相对简单,但在实际操作中,可能会有用户遇到各种问题。了解一些常见问题的解决方式,可以帮助用户高效排查并处理困难。
常见问题解答:
1. 如何选择虚拟机软件?
根据个人需求,选择功能丰富的VMware或开源的VirtualBox,企业用户可考虑Hyper-V。
2. 虚拟机对系统性能有影响吗?
是的,虚拟机会占用宿主机的CPU、内存和存储资源,配置合理可以减轻影响。
3. 如何优化虚拟机性能?
启用硬件虚拟化,合理配置RAM与CPU,利用SSD作为存储,选择轻量级的Linux发行版。
4. Linux虚拟机如何与Windows共享文件?
可以使用共享文件夹功能,或通过Samba等网络共享服务实现文件交换。
5. 在虚拟机上无法连接互联网,怎么办?
检查网络设置,确保网络模式正确设置,并确保虚拟机的网络适配器已启用。
通过虚拟机技术,用户能够在Windows环境中体验Linux的魅力,掌握操作系统搭建的技巧和优化方法,将为自己的技术学习和职业发展增添极大的助力。
